
Sometimes, the best option to treat depression isn’t medication, but rather a non-medication approach called Transcranial magnetic stimulation (TMS) therapy. TMS is an entirely non-invasive procedure widely used in the treatment of depression, anxiety, PTSD, and obsessive-compulsive disorder.
Typically, TMS treatment is performed four to five times per week for several weeks. Sessions usually last about 40 minutes. If you feel that the medication you take to manage your depression isn’t helping, talk to your doctor, and see if TMS may be right for you.
Although it is an FDA approved treatment, not all insurances cover TMS treatment yet.
